Java是一種廣泛使用的編程語言,其應(yīng)用范圍廣泛,涉及個人應(yīng)用、大型企業(yè)級應(yīng)用以及服務(wù)器端應(yīng)用。Java程序設(shè)計是Java開發(fā)的核心,它涵蓋了Java應(yīng)用程序中使用的一系列基本概念、設(shè)計原理和開發(fā)流程。
Java程序設(shè)計的基本原理包括面向?qū)ο笤O(shè)計、封裝、多態(tài)、繼承、異常處理等。程序設(shè)計的目的是盡可能地簡化代碼開發(fā)、提高代碼的可維護性和可擴展性。這就要求程序員在編寫Java代碼時,要遵循上述原則。
在Java程序設(shè)計過程中,為了提高代碼質(zhì)量和效率,可以使用范例進行學(xué)習(xí)和借鑒。例如,以下代碼為Java實現(xiàn)打印“Hello World”應(yīng)用的基本范例:
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ello World!");
}
}
這是一個簡單的Java類,其中包括了一個基本的main方法和一個打印語句“Hello World!”。它可以作為學(xué)習(xí)Java程序設(shè)計的初始范例,以幫助程序員更好地掌握J(rèn)ava的基本語法和開發(fā)流程。
除了“Hello World”應(yīng)用,Java范例還包括了其他眾多應(yīng)用程序的實現(xiàn),例如圖形界面應(yīng)用、網(wǎng)絡(luò)應(yīng)用、安全應(yīng)用等。程序員可以通過學(xué)習(xí)這些范例,深入了解Java語言和Java程序設(shè)計的核心原理和技術(shù),提高自己的編程技巧和水平。